United States—U.S. Statistics—Census Data—Georgia
QuickFacts from the US Census Bureau
Georgia
| | People QuickFacts | Bibb County | Georgia |
| Population, 2005 estimate | 154,918 | 9,072,576 |
| Population, percent change, April 1, 2000 to July 1, 2005 | 0.7% | 10.8% |
| Population, 2000 | 153,887 | 8,186,453 |
| Persons under 5 years old, percent, 2005 | 7.9% | 7.6% |
| Persons under 18 years old, percent, 2005 | 26.9% | 26.0% |
| Persons 65 years old and over, percent, 2005 | 12.6% | 9.6% |
| Female persons, percent, 2005 | 53.9% | 50.5% |
| |
| White persons, percent, 2005 (a) | 47.5% | 66.1% |
| Black persons, percent, 2005 (a) | 50.3% | 29.8% |
| American Indian and Alaska Native persons, percent, 2005 (a) | 0.2% | 0.3% |
| Asian persons, percent, 2005 (a) | 1.4% | 2.7% |
| Native Hawaiian and Other Pacific Islander, percent, 2005 (a) | 0.0% | 0.1% |
| Persons reporting two or more races, percent, 2005 | 0.7% | 1.0% |
| Persons of Hispanic or Latino origin, percent, 2005 (b) | 1.6% | 7.1% |
| White persons not Hispanic, percent, 2005 | 46.2% | 59.6% |
| |
| Living in same house in 1995 and 2000, pct 5 yrs old & over | 53.0% | 49.2% |
| Foreign born persons, percent, 2000 | 1.9% | 7.1% |
| Language other than English spoken at home, pct age 5+, 2000 | 4.0% | 9.9% |
| High school graduates, percent of persons age 25+, 2000 | 77.2% | 78.6% |
| Bachelor's degree or higher, pct of persons age 25+, 2000 | 21.3% | 24.3% |
| Persons with a disability, age 5+, 2000 | 31,714 | 1,456,812 |
| Mean travel time to work (minutes), workers age 16+, 2000 | 22.2 | 27.7 |
| |
| Housing units, 2005 | 70,608 | 3,771,466 |
| Homeownership rate, 2000 | 58.8% | 67.5% |
| Housing units in multi-unit structures, percent, 2000 | 28.6% | 20.8% |
| Median value of owner-occupied housing units, 2000 | $84,400 | $111,200 |
| |
| Households, 2000 | 59,667 | 3,006,369 |
| Persons per household, 2000 | 2.49 | 2.65 |
| Median household income, 2003 | $35,169 | $42,421 |
| Per capita money income, 1999 | $19,058 | $21,154 |
| Persons below poverty, percent, 2003 | 18.9% | 13.3% |
